Transaction 75df09909f3cdcc772aefcdfe685233ba643066b89204cd4ebd5feec91c11e38

1 Input
2 Outputs
  • 75df09909f3cdcc772aefcdfe685233ba643066b89204cd4ebd5feec91c11e38:0
  • value  1305
    address  1Q2Twh4qfPfeFZRAnxeZ3ARfBrjACg8LBX
  • 75df09909f3cdcc772aefcdfe685233ba643066b89204cd4ebd5feec91c11e38:1
  • value  102516
    address  3GmPGr4EoQFeGPUziSgeTZCHSKFjNkMRBm